Release Notes 3 New Features This section lists features added since the last release of this product. Release 5.0.0/5.0.1 The following are new features in this release. Support for In-Database Connectors Instead of always using the in-memory d ata engine, TIBCO Spotfire 5.0.0 can now use an external system as an alternative data engine, and, instead of bringing all data into memory, perform calculations and aggregations in the external system. That way TIBCO Spotfire 5.0.0 can handle data volumes too large to fit into primary memory. Support for Teradata as an In-Database Data Source TIBCO Spotfire can now connect directly with Teradata and have Teradata perform aggregations and calculations in-db. Spotfire will also automatically recreate any dimensional model in Spotfire if such a model exists in the Terad ata database. Note that the Teradata.NET Data Provid er must be installed on the machine running the Terad ata connector. Click here to download the driver. Support for Oracle as an In-Database Data Source TIBCO Spotfire can now connect directly with Oracle and have Oracle perform aggregations and calculations in-db. Spotfire will also automatically recreate any dimensional model in Spotfire if such a model exists in the Oracle database. Note that the Oracle Data Provider for.net4 must be installed on the machine running the Oracle connector. Click here to download the driver for 64- bit ODAC. Support for Microsoft SQL Server as an In-Database Data Source TIBCO Spotfire can now connect directly with Microsoft SQL Server and have Microsoft SQL Server perform aggregations and calculations in-db. Spotfire will also automatically recreate any dimensional model in Spotfire if such a model exists in the SQL Server database. Support for Microsoft SQL Server Analysis Services as an In- Database Data Source With TIBCO Spotfire 5.0.0 it is now possible to connect directly to Microsoft SQL Server Analysis Services OLAP cube and use the attribute hierarchies, user hierarchies and measures directly in Spotfire visualizations. Spotfire will create native MDX queries to query Analysis Services. Note that the ADOMD.NET driver must be installed on the machine running the Analysis Services connector. Click here to download the driver for Microsoft Analysis Services 2008 R2, and here to download the driver for Microsoft Analysis Services 2012. Search for ADOMD.NET and select the 64-bit version.
Release Notes 4 Client Job Sender Executes Jobs Asynchronously Client Job Sender will now execute jobs using an asynchronous web service, to avoid timeouts. The Job Sender still exits when the job is finished. To avoid waiting for a job to finish, use the /async flag. Logging of the Automation Services Web Service The Automation Services web service now has logging. It uses the same log as the worker process on the server.

Release Notes 8 Closed Issues Closed In Release Key The table in this section list issues that were closed in the named release. Summary 5.0.0 TSAS-331 When running jobs asynchronously using Client Job Sender (using the / async flag) temporary files are not deleted on the server. 5.0.0 TSAS-320 In some cases, the Job Build er will report success before a job has finished executing on the server, if the Automation Services web application restarts, recycles, or fails. 5.0.0 TSAS-337 Some fields in the Export to PDF task are hidden in the Job Builder dialog. 5.0.0 TSAS-300 Pages are printed in the wrong order when selecting the option "N ew page for each visualization".
Release Notes 9 Known Issues Key TSAS-281 TSAS-253 TS-26428 TS-26929 TS-26446 The table in this section lists known issues in this release. Summary/Workaround Summary It is not possible to Export to PDF using filter settings from an Automation Services task. Workaround Create separate analysis files with various filter settings, and export each one individ ually. Summary If the task exports a tabular visualization or a text area, the export might result in an empty image, without any error or logging message. Specifically sparklines, calculated values, icons, and bullet graphs may cause this issue. This applies to the following tasks: Export Image, Export to PDF, and Send Email. Workaround In the spotfire.dxp.automation.launcher.exe.config file, increase the VisualWebViewIdleTimoutMs timeout. Summary When using sets from Microsoft SQL Server Analysis Services in a cross table and enabling subtotal and grand total, a configuration error will be displayed in the visualization. Workaround None. Summary When having duplicate attribute hierarchy values and d o a Color by that attribute hierarchy, duplicate hierarchy values get the same color even though they represent different logical entities. Workaround None. Summary When using a dynamic named set from Microsoft SQL Server Analysis Services and set up a filtering operation that affects the result of the dynamic set, it will result in a broken visualization with the error message, The data columns from the external con nection do not match. Workaround None.
